## Runbook: Grainmill CSV Import Wizard

Scope: security review of the upload path. The wizard parses CSVs in a sandboxed worker; files over the size cap are rejected before parsing. Formula-injection characters are escaped on export. Temp files are purged after each job. Audit events go to the Grainmill log sink with a 90-day retention. Review the parser flags against policy. The active configuration is shown below.

settings of tagef-bawif:
DRUIX_HOST=druix.zemvarlabs.internal
DRUIX_PORT=8000

Quarterly Planning Note — Headcount, Orvano Systems

Board summary: next year's plan holds total headcount flat. Net adds of twelve in engineering for the Skylark platform, offset by attrition in back-office roles, not backfilled. Branch staffing at Wexcombe unchanged. Hiring freeze lifts only on committee approval. Contractor spend capped at current levels. The strategic context informing these numbers is recorded below.

internal memo for faweg-tafog: Only 7 of the 100 pilot accounts renewed Quenael, so a churn review is set for April 15.

It scrapes local endpoints every 15s, batches, and ships to the Drossfield collector. Review priorities: no blocking calls in the flush path, label cardinality stays bounded, and config changes must be backward-compatible since fleets roll slowly. The sidecar runs under a scoped service identity; rotation is automated, so reviewers never handle live credentials. The one exception is the offline recovery flow for the staging collector, which is gated by the passphrase noted just below.

vault phrase of tajop-haduf = holath-brivan-wenax